WebIn such situations, water will move across the membrane to balance the concentration of the solutes on both sides. Cells tend to lose water (their solvent) in hypertonic environments (where there are more solutes outside than inside the cell) and gain water in hypotonic environments (where there are fewer solutes outside than inside the cell). WebWhen sugar molecules are added to side B, it becomes hypertonic because there are more sugar molecules than side A. Water moves across the membrane, from the less concentrated (hypotonic) side A to the more concentrated (hypertonic) side B, until the concentration is equal on both sides. This is called equilibrium.
